How to sort a string with digits and letters (digits before letters) in C++

1 Answer

0 votes
#include <iostream>
#include <string>
#include <algorithm>

int main() {
    std::string str = "d2c4b3a1";

    // Custom comparator: letters before digits
    std::sort(str.begin(), str.end(), [](char a, char b) {
        if (std::isdigit(a) && std::isalpha(b)) return true;
        if (std::isalpha(a) && std::isdigit(b)) return false;
        return a < b;
    });

    std::cout << str << std::endl;
}

 
 
/*
run:
 
1234abcd
 
*/
